What is Travel Insurance?
Travel insurance is a type of insurance designed to cover the costs and losses associated with traveling. It can provide coverage for a variety of scenarios, including trip cancellations, medical emergencies, lost luggage, and other unforeseen events. Understanding what travel insurance covers is crucial for making informed decisions.
Key Components of Travel Insurance Policies
- Trip Cancellation or Interruption: This covers the costs if you need to cancel or cut short your trip due to unforeseen circumstances, such as illness or family emergencies.
- Medical Coverage: If you encounter a medical issue while traveling, this coverage ensures that you receive necessary medical treatment without incurring exorbitant out-of-pocket expenses.
- Emergency Evacuation: In case of serious medical emergencies, this component covers the costs of transporting you to the nearest medical facility or back home.
- Lost or Delayed Luggage: This covers the financial loss if your luggage is lost, stolen, or delayed, helping you to recover some costs for essential items.
- Travel Delays: If your trip is delayed due to weather or other issues, this coverage can reimburse you for additional expenses incurred, such as accommodation and meals.

How to Effectively Compare Travel Insurance Plans
When comparing travel insurance policies, consider the following steps:
- Assess Your Needs: Determine what type of coverage is essential for your trip. If you’re traveling internationally, medical coverage may be a priority.
- Gather Multiple Quotes: Utilize online insurance comparison sites to gather quotes from various providers. This will help you see a range of options and prices.
- Read the Fine Print: Carefully review policy details, including coverage limits, deductibles, and exclusions. This will help you avoid unpleasant surprises later.
- Check Reviews: Look for customer reviews and ratings for different insurance companies to gauge their reliability and customer service.
- Contact Providers: If you have specific questions or unique needs, don’t hesitate to reach out to insurance providers for clarification before making a decision.
